Collecting Evidence

To be successful in a truck crash injury case, Lawyers Truck Accident for families and victims typically must gather evidence to prove that the accident occurred and who should be held financially accountable. This could require a variety of types of evidence, including photos, witness statements and medical documents.

It is vital to gather evidence in any personal injury case. However, it is more important in cases involving large commercial trucks. Because these accidents are distinct, they require different types of evidence to substantiate a claim.

A large part of this is obtaining information from the trucker and company. A lawyer representing the victim is required to get these documents as soon as they are available, as well as electronic data that may be stored on the truck's dashboard, or onboard recording devices.

This type of evidence often can be extremely beneficial to a legal team representing the victim, as it can provide information about the behavior and habits of the driver that may help bolster the claim for damages. Particularly, the data collected by the truck's electronic data collection systems can give crucial information regarding the circumstances surrounding an accident.

Another type of evidence that could be useful in a case is the data from a cell phone. Data collected from a driver's mobile phone can give valuable insight into their driving habits prior to the moment of an accident.

The lawyer representing the victim of a crash has to keep that data safe. They must be quick to ensure that it doesn't disappear or get deleted before they are able to access it.

The other evidence of importance that the lawyer for a victim of a truck accident may want is the documents pertaining to the inspection and maintenance of the truck. These can show that the trucking firm's carelessness and negligence. They could also expose the violations of the law that could be a factor in the case for compensation.

It's also important to record any witnesses who were present at the scene of the crash, as they can provide more insight into the causes of a crash. Also, the names and contact details for these individuals could be vital to the development of a case in the future.
